QEMU doesn't yet have a good way to specify migration parameters so that
they can be available even during early stage of QEMU boots.  It is because
the migration object (who owns the migration parameters) will only be
created after PHASE_LATE_BACKENDS_CREATED.  It means anything before it
reading migration parameters is illegal.

However, QEMU does have special use cases for such, namely only-migratable
flag, and cpr-transfer. Recently, we have one more possible user to read a
to-be-introduced new migration parameters during backend initialization
phase.  We can introduce yet another global variable (or per-device
parameter) to bypass this limitation, but we can also seek for a generic
solution that we can setup migration parameters very early, even during
backend initializations.

This patch wants to take the latter approach.

As a start, introduce a new way to specify migration parameters in QEMU
boot commandline, as proposed in the above discussion:

   -incoming config:key1=value1,key2=value2,...

When specified, QEMU will parse a string formatted MigrationParameters and
keep it.  When migration object is created, it will apply all the settings
as initial value.

Since the application of boot parameters will be after object_new()
completes, it means it happens after all machine compat properties or
-global settings (which should be done during instance_post_init()).

So far, it's still only a way to specify parameters.  All parameters are
not visible before migration object created, like before.  Any parameter
that needs to be visible during boot will need to opt-in this feature.
Follow up patches will switch the current users to use this model.

In this case, after we set current_migration pointer compat properties are
applied, due to instance_post_init() happening within object_new().


Yes, but migration_properties has two distinct sets of Properties, one
contains only compat properties that match machine.c properties and the
other has properties that go into MigrationParameters. I was under the
impression that we never tied compat to parameters.

The only machine compat property that is also a migration parameter I
see is zero-page-detection. Maybe we shouldn't have done that. Now we
can't decouple MigrationParameters from -global. Unless, of course we
declare that from now on compat needs to be done with a new property
that's not part of MigrationParameters; and duplicate
zero-page-detection.

I always treated migration parameters to be a subset of what we can apply
to compat properties in the past.


Good to know.

For example, -global almost works the same as compat properties and also at
the same time, currently both done in device_post_init().

In the future, if your series to convert caps to parameters work, then I
also want to add even more "parameters" (which used to be caps, like
postcopy preempt mode) into lists of machine compat properties, so e.g. we
can enable preempt mode by default.

I hope that makes it useful, but if you still see some benefits of
splitting the two things (compat properties / parameters), let me know.  I
may not have fully caught what you're visioning.


The problem I see is a long-standing one: MigrationParameters needs to
be embedded into MigrationState because of -global (as both compat and
debug feature). As long as that holds, we'll need workarounds such as
having this extra early state.

But let's not make this a problem to be solved in this series, please
disconsider this discussion.

Just to wrap my thoughts, for reference:

What I want is a migration-owned MigrationParameters that we can do
anything with, decoupled from whatever is needed to expose compat
properties. There's two ways to achieve this: One is to declare
parameters are separate from compat and drop the debug usage (what I
suggested in my previous email). The other is to make MigrationState
stop being a QOM object and instead make MigrationParameters itself be a
QOM object. Then we could reference its members directly from qdev.
